Former APC National Chairman, Abdullahi Ganduje has said that Peter Obi and Rabiu Musa Kwankwaso presidential ticket under the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C) stands no chance of winning Kano State in the 2027 general election.

Speaking to journalists on Tuesday, the former Kano governor said the ticket lacks the political strength and leadership record needed to win support in the state.

“I don’t think Peter Obi and Kwankwaso’s ticket will succeed in Kano. It will not succeed. In fact, it is dead on arrival,” Ganduje said.

He questioned Obi’s performance as Anambra governor, asking, “What did he do as a governor? What legacy did he leave as a governor?”

Ganduje also said Obi had not shown enough experience in governance to lead Nigeria.

Turning to Kwankwaso, he noted that the former Kano governor did not win two consecutive terms in office, unlike Ibrahim Shekarau and himself.

Ganduje added that Kwankwaso had not left a legacy that would convince Kano people or Nigerians that he could serve successfully as vice-president, insisting once again that the proposed ticket is dead on arrival.
